I'm in the market for a GS and I went to look at a 95 with 125K on the dash. Overall the car was in very good condition. There were some minor cosmetic issues that need to be addressed. While in the car I cycled through the gears, going from Park to Drive. When I put the car in reverse the car sort of jerked. When I put the car in Drive, there was also jerking. While driving the car, the shifting was smooth. Is the jerking a tell tell sign that the car may have transmission issues? The fluid wasn't low and there was no burning smell. The car has been sitting for a couple months awaiting a new owner. Could this be culprit of the jerking? Or are the two not correlated?
Any insight is greatly appreciated.

Ive got the same issue with my 93. It only jerks when its cold or when u first start it. In my case, its because of the high idel speed when u first start it up in combination with a bad transmission mount. Runs about 1400 rpm then drops down after its warm then its fine. im gona fix mine, just havnt had time.
#7
Im going with the tranny mount, if you say the car shifts fine while driving, if it was banging through gears when you where driving then Id say its the tranny..The tranny mount is pretty damn cheap to by, and if u have some mech skills u can do it yourself w jack stands, a jack a socket wrench Im sure...good luck...and keep us posted...
